Solar Bocce Court Lighting

Advantages of Solar-Powered LED Lights

Solar lights operate independently of the grid, reducing electrical dependency and associated costs. They charge during the day and illuminate the court at night, ensuring consistent lighting without ongoing expenses. LED lights, known for their longevity and low power consumption, complement solar technology perfectly. They offer bright, uniform lighting essential for optimal visibility and gameplay.

Design Considerations for Solar Bocce Court Lighting

When designing lighting for a solar-powered bocce court, several factors must be considered to achieve the best results. The placement and spacing of lights are critical to ensure even illumination across the court. Solar lights should be positioned to maximize sun exposure during the day, which in turn ensures optimal battery charging. The design must also account for potential shading from surrounding structures or vegetation, which could affect the performance of the solar panels.

Optimal Lighting Levels for Bocce Courts

For nighttime play, the recommended light level ranges between 10 to 20 foot-candles. This level of illumination supports clear visibility of the bocce balls and court boundaries. LED fixtures are capable of delivering this brightness while remaining energy-efficient. Adjustments in lighting intensity can be made depending on the specific needs of the court and user preferences.

Placement and Angle of Solar Lights

The effectiveness of solar lighting depends significantly on proper placement and angling. Lights should be positioned to cover the entire playing surface without creating harsh shadows or glare. Fixtures should be installed at an angle that optimizes the coverage while minimizing any obstruction to the light path. Adjustable mounting options allow for fine-tuning of light direction, ensuring comprehensive illumination that supports all aspects of the game.

Weather Resistance and Durability

Solar LED lights used for bocce courts must be designed to withstand various weather conditions. They should be built with durable, weather-resistant materials to endure rain, wind, and temperature fluctuations. High-quality solar fixtures are typically encased in robust housings that protect sensitive components from the elements. This durability ensures that the lighting system remains functional and reliable throughout the year, providing consistent performance regardless of weather conditions.

Maintenance and Longevity

LEDs have a long operational life, often exceeding 120,000 hours, reducing the need for frequent replacements. Solar panels also require minimal upkeep, typically needing only periodic cleaning to maintain efficiency. Regular inspections should be conducted to ensure that the solar panels and LED fixtures are functioning correctly and to address any potential issues promptly.
